Wild Wadi Waterpark Rules & Safety Tips
Rules to keep in mind when visiting Wild Wadi Waterpark What you can bring Facilities Rules & tips
✅ Allowed:
One sealed 1-liter water bottle per person GoPro-style cameras (allowed on most rides except Jumeirah Sceirah , must be strapped)🚫 Not allowed:
Outside food, glass containers, or sharp objects Alcohol, smoking devices outside designated areas Any unauthorized inflatables or water gear Baby food and formula may be permitted at the discretion of security staff.
🧳 Essentials & rentals
Lockers : Available in small, medium, and large sizes (AED 45–85) with secure wristband accessTowel rental : ~AED 25 per towelLife jackets : Complimentary and required on select ridesSwim accessories : Forgot something? Pick up swim diapers, waterproof phone pouches, lanyards, or sunscreen from park shops🍔 Dining
Wild Wadi has 2–3 main outlets , offering fast-casual fare like burgers, pizzas, wraps, and kids’ combos Expect to pay AED 65–120 per meal Vegetarian, halal, and kids’ meals available No outside food allowed, but one sealed water bottle (1L) per guest is permitted 🌞 Health, hygiene & comfort tips
Apply sunscreen frequently—Dubai sun is no joke!Stay hydrated —bring water or refill at fountainsShower before rides for hygiene and safetyUse shaded areas to cool down between rides 🛑 Conduct & behavior
Prohibited behaviors : Running, pushing, queue-jumping, shouting, aggressive languageSmoking is allowed only in designated areasIntoxicated guests will not be allowed entryWild Wadi reserves the right to remove anyone violating park rules
